MySQL中增加整型字段的语句及示例

在数据库管理中,我们经常需要对表结构进行调整,以适应不断变化的业务需求。其中,增加字段是常见的操作之一。本文将介绍如何在MySQL数据库中增加整型字段,并提供相应的语句和示例。

整型字段概述

在MySQL中,整型字段用于存储整数数据,包括正数、负数和零。常见的整型字段类型有:

  • TINYINT:1字节,范围 -128 到 127
  • SMALLINT:2字节,范围 -32768 到 32767
  • MEDIUMINT:3字节,范围 -8388608 到 8388607
  • INT:4字节,范围 -2147483648 到 2147483647
  • BIGINT:8字节,范围 -9223372036854775808 到 9223372036854775807

增加整型字段的语句

在MySQL中,增加整型字段可以使用ALTER TABLE语句。基本语法如下:

ALTER TABLE table_name
ADD COLUMN column_name column_type;
  • 1.
  • 2.

其中,table_name是要修改的表名,column_name是新增加的字段名,column_type是字段类型。

示例

假设我们有一个名为employees的表,用于存储员工信息。现在我们需要增加一个名为age的整型字段,用于存储员工的年龄。以下是具体的SQL语句:

ALTER TABLE employees
ADD COLUMN age INT;
  • 1.
  • 2.

执行上述语句后,employees表将增加一个名为age的整型字段。

关系图

为了更直观地展示表结构,我们可以使用Mermaid语法绘制关系图。以下是employees表的ER图:

EMPLOYEES int id PK Employee ID string name Employee Name int age Employee Age DEPARTMENTS int id PK Department ID string name Department Name works_in

总结

本文介绍了在MySQL中增加整型字段的方法,包括基本语法和示例。通过使用ALTER TABLE语句,我们可以轻松地对表结构进行调整,以满足业务需求。同时,通过关系图,我们可以更直观地了解表结构和它们之间的关系。

在实际应用中,我们还需要考虑字段的默认值、是否允许为空等因素。希望本文能帮助您更好地理解和掌握在MySQL中增加整型字段的操作。